Latest Patents

Driggs holds a patent titled "Robust Pulse Deinterleaving." This invention focuses on associating time slices of a received signal with previously encountered time slices. A parameter determination component within his system identifies at least one parameter for each received time slice. Additionally, a content addressable memory stores a variety of parameter values linked to these encountered time slices. This memory is searchable, enabling the comparison of determined parameters to provide effective matching through an emitter matching component.
